Search Engine Placement Optimization or SEO
Search Engine Placement Optimization or SEO
Search engine placement optimization, other wise known as SEO is a method used by webmasters to get page 1 rankings. There are two types of ‘traffic’ thet a website can receive, ‘paid’ and ‘organic’.
There are many different techniques that webmasters use to get front page organic listings including on-page optimization and off-page optimization. The on-page optimization includes having your chosen keywords in theee title and first paragraph(which is how you may be reading theeis article right now) and off page is to do with getting back links to your site.
Search engine placement optimization includes image searches, local searches, video searches and industry specific searches called vertical searches. By using many different searches you gain a better ‘web presence’.
If you work in SEO consulting or Internet marketing theeen it is critical to understand how theee search engines work. There is one search engine today that is dominating theee market and is the one you probably used to find this article. Google has over 70% of theee current market. Having the knowledge of being able to see what people are typing in to theee search engines is also a vital skill and is entirely possible.
For good search engine placement optimization the webmaster will need specific skills in how to edit website content and the HTML of a website. An important point to note is that if a search engine finds any evidence of spamming all the work of optimization may be invalid.
It has been the rise of the Internet that has given the term SEO its name with the increasing demand for good consultants with the skill. Their main goal is to make the website as search engine friendly as they can.
Another useful term to know is ‘Black hat’ and ‘White hat’. Black hat methods are frowned upon and the white hat methods are the techniques previously discussed. The use of link farms, keyword stuffing and article spinning is what is disapproved of by the search engines.
This results in search results being distorted and can be frustrating for the web user. If the search engines find any evidence of these methods the website will be ’sand bagged’ and may not show up in the listings for many months.
There are now billions of websites on the World Wide Web today and this is only going to double and triple over the coming years. The Internet is still on its infancy. The web as we know it today will be very different in 5 years from now. Skills in search engine placement optimization will always be needed as we head into the next generation.

A non-Flash-based website which relies on hard text,
is far easier to be indexed by search robots. Limit
the use of stylized text saved as .gifs since as a
graphic, they are not indexable by search robots.
Avoid use of frames since any number of search robots
are unable to properly classify textual material.
Placement of Metatags:
A ranking or search order does take place with Google
and Yahoo and it begins with the “Title” metag which
should consist of no more than 65 characters separated
by commas. The “Title” should describe in generic
terms, the goods and services, followed by a location
from which the resource is located, i.e., city, state.
The placement of a domain name which is not generic
within the “Title” is not appropriate, unless your
domain name is a major recognizable brand name.
The second metatag is the “Description” which is
usually 25-30 words to form a complete sentence which
best describes one’s goods and services.
And the very last category – “Keywords” are also
somewhat limited to 15-16 words which can be plural
and compound in nature. Again, avoid multiple entries
which could be mistaken as “spamdexed entries” which
is defined as the loading, and submission of
repetitive words into a particular metatag category.
“Spamdexing” when discovered on a webpage and reported
to Google’s spamreport.com can result in the
elimination of your website from their search
directory.
